43-38433

Delivered Cheyenne 2/8/44; Kearney 12/8/44; Grenier 22/8/44; Assigned 18BS/34BG Mendlesham 30/8/44; t/o accident with Elmer Rawson 13/4/45; Salvaged 14/4/45.
